Abstract

•We develop a H3SE performance excellence model in hazardous industries.•Model was assessed in 21 Iranian petrochemical companies.•Model validity were tested by three multiple attribute decision making approaches (classical, TOPSIS and PROMETHEE).•Convergence of rankings has been evaluated.

Performance assessment of Iranian petrochemical companies based on the H3SE performance excellence model is the purpose of this paper. Reaching this goal, different aspects of the sustainable excellence model and its indices have been introduced, and through Multiple Attribute Decision-Making (MADM) approaches, Iranian petrochemical companies were assessed and ranked. Since the results of MADM are not panacea for all decision making problems and the questionnaire self-assessment approach is not rigorous enough, different techniques have been involved for compensation. In the following, the convergence of MADM rankings has been compared. The findings signify that processes management, leadership, social environmental accountability and staff results are of relative importance in H3SE performance assessment. Moreover, Ethylene Gharb, Zagros, and Bandar Imam companies have the highest rankings. Finally, ranking sensitivity was analyzed. Since the data were collected through questionnaire self-assessment approach, the reliability of this assessment may be doubted.
